Abstract :
We study a one-dimensional transport equation with nonlocal velocity which was recently considered
in the work of Córdoba, Córdoba and Fontelos [A. Córdoba, D. Córdoba, M.A. Fontelos, Formation of
singularities for a transport equation with nonlocal velocity, Ann. of Math. (2) 162 (3) (2005) 1377–1389].
We show that in the subcritical and critical cases the problem is globally well-posed with arbitrary initial
data in Hmax{3/2−γ,0}. While in the supercritical case, the problem is locally well-posed with initial data
in H3/2−γ , and is globally well-posed under a smallness assumption. Some polynomial-in-time decay
estimates are also discussed. These results improve some previous results in [A. Córdoba, D. Córdoba,
M.A. Fontelos, Formation of singularities for a transport equation with nonlocal velocity, Ann. of Math. (2)
162 (3) (2005) 1377–1389].
